- Communicate and work collaboratively with CDC and other UC, SOPAG-appointed, task forces and other common interest groups on special collections issues.
- Work with CDL on digitizing projects that might involve special collections materials.
- Continue to work with OAC on collaborative projects such as Cal Cultures and submit guides/images to OAC.
- Continue to explore ways to reduce processing backlogs, with projects such as the Bancroft’s EAD Encoding Services and the creation of a similar template for Metadata Encoding and Transmission Standard (METS).
- Explore the feasibility of a post-MLS fellowship program within the University of California, for the training of rare books/ special collections librarians.
- Maintain and expand content of HOSC web site.
- Continue to meet regularly (in person or otherwise) to discuss UC-wide Special Collections issues, as addressed in the HOSC Charge and Statement of Purpose, and explore ways to address them. Next proposed meeting is November 13, 2006, via conference call.
